What Marble Polishing Actually Does
Polishing is often misunderstood. Many people assume it means simply buffing the floor or applying a glossy chemical. These temporary methods only create short-term shine and do not remove scratches or stains. The dullness returns quickly.
True marble polishing is a mechanical restoration process.
We use specialised machines fitted with industrial diamond abrasives to grind away a thin layer of damaged marble. This removes surface scratches, etching, stains, and unevenness permanently. The stone is then refined step by step with finer abrasives until it becomes smooth and naturally reflective.
Instead of hiding defects, we correct them at the stone level.
After proper polishing, the floor becomes:
-
Smooth and level
-
Even in finish
-
Naturally bright
-
Less porous
-
Easier to clean and maintain
The results are durable and suitable for everyday use.
Common Problems Seen in Marble Floors
In residential and light commercial properties, marble floors face constant wear. Over time, several issues become noticeable.
Dull and cloudy appearance
Continuous walking creates tiny scratches that reduce light reflection.
Scratches and drag marks
Moving beds, tables, or office furniture leaves visible lines.
Stains and dark patches
Oil, tea, food spills, and water seep into marble pores and leave stubborn marks.
Uneven shine
High-traffic areas wear faster than corners, creating patchy spots.
Chemical damage
Harsh or acidic cleaners react with marble and cause dull etched areas.
Most of these problems affect only the top surface and can be corrected through professional grinding and polishing.

Step-by-Step Professional Work Process
Each marble floor is handled carefully using a systematic approach to ensure consistent and long-lasting results.
Inspection and assessment
We first examine the marble type, thickness, scratches, stains, and cracks to decide the right treatment.
Cleaning and preparation
The floor is thoroughly cleaned to remove dust and residues. Furniture is moved safely, and nearby areas are protected.
Diamond grinding & polishing
Coarse diamond pads remove deeper scratches and unevenness. Finer pads gradually smooth and refine the surface until it becomes flat and uniform.
This permanently removes defects rather than hiding them.
Epoxy filling for pinholes & cracks
Small holes and hairline cracks are filled with colour-matched epoxy to create a seamless and stronger finish.
Silicate hardening treatment
A silicate-based hardener is applied to densify the marble, improving resistance to wear and moisture.
Final polishing
Fine abrasives and polishing compounds develop the marble’s natural sheen. The finish can be matte, satin, or glossy depending on preference.
Nano coating & surface sealing
Finally, a nano sealer protects the stone from stains and water absorption, making daily maintenance easier.

Simple Maintenance Tips
To keep your marble looking good:
-
Use soft mops or microfibre cloths
-
Clean with mild, pH-neutral solutions
-
Avoid harsh or acidic chemicals
-
Wipe spills quickly
-
Place mats near entrances
-
Use pads under furniture legs
These small habits help maintain the shine.
